Answer: would probably have come with us.
A verb phrase consists of a main verb with its auxiliaries and its objects, complements or other modifiers. In this case:
- <em>would, have: </em>auxiliary verb.
- <em>probably: </em>adverb (modifier).
- <em>come:</em> main verb.
- <em>with us: </em>complement.
(Although this would be the most accepted definition, different theories could include different elements in a verbal phrase).
